Statistics
Principles for implementing transparent variable derivation algorithms that can be audited and reproduced consistently.
Transparent variable derivation requires auditable, reproducible processes; this evergreen guide outlines robust principles for building verifiable algorithms whose results remain trustworthy across methods and implementers.
X Linkedin Facebook Reddit Email Bluesky
Published by Joseph Perry
July 29, 2025 - 3 min Read
As data pipelines grow more complex, the demand for transparent variable derivation increases. Teams must design methods that clearly separate data inputs, transformation rules, and final outputs. Visibility into how intermediate results are computed helps stakeholders question assumptions, verify correctness, and diagnose failures without guesswork. A well-documented lineage shows when and why a variable changes, which values influenced it, and how edge cases are handled. Implementers should prioritize modularity, so that each transformation is isolated, testable, and replaceable without disturbing the rest of the system. This approach reduces fragility and strengthens accountability across the entire analytics stack.
To begin, establish a formal specification of all variables involved in derivations. Define data types, acceptable ranges, boundaries, and treatment of missing values. When algorithms rely on statistical estimators or machine learning models, record the exact configuration, seeds, and preprocessing steps used. A standardized pseudocode or flowchart aids verification by humans and machines alike. Documentation should also indicate which parts are deterministic and which incorporate randomness, along with the procedures for reproducing results in different environments. Clear specifications enable auditors to reproduce outcomes and assess whether results align with stated goals.
Mechanisms for auditing must be explicit and consistently applied.
Reproducibility hinges on consistent environments and predictable behavior. To achieve this, version-control all code, data schemas, and model checkpoints, ensuring that any change is traceable. Use containerization or environment managers to lock down software dependencies, compiler versions, and hardware considerations that might influence results. Test harnesses should exercise edge cases and boundary conditions, documenting how the system behaves under unusual inputs. Additionally, implement strict access controls to protect against unauthorized alterations while maintaining an auditable trail of changes. Collectively, these practices create a dependable foundation for independent verification by external researchers.
ADVERTISEMENT
ADVERTISEMENT
Auditing derives trust when every step of the derivation is explainable. Provide human-readable narratives that accompany each variable, describing the logic that maps inputs to outputs. When possible, generate automatic explanations that highlight influential features or steps, enabling reviewers to follow the reasoning path. Record performance metrics and error analyses alongside results to reveal how derivations respond to data shifts. Periodic external audits, coupled with internal governance reviews, help identify blind spots and ensure that the system remains aligned with stated objectives. A culture of transparency ultimately reinforces confidence in the results.
Provenance and versioning enable trustworthy, long-term reproducibility.
In practice, you should implement deterministic baselines for all core derivations. Even when stochastic components exist, capture seeds, random number generator states, and sampling strategies so that full reruns reproduce identical outcomes. Maintain a central registry of derivation steps, each annotated with dependencies, inputs, and expected outputs. This registry should be queryable, enabling researchers to reconstruct a complete derivation graph and inspect provenance at any node. The aim is to make every transformation legible, traceable, and resistant to ad hoc modification. By enforcing centralized provenance, you reduce the risk of unnoticed drift across iterations and models.
ADVERTISEMENT
ADVERTISEMENT
Another essential practice is data lineage tracing across time. Track the evolution of inputs, intermediate states, and final decisions as datasets are updated. Maintain snapshots or immutable references to historical states to support backtracking when inconsistencies arise. When a variable’s meaning shifts due to schema changes or policy updates, document the rationale and impact on downstream computations. This historical discipline helps auditors compare alternative versions and assess whether shifts were intentional and justified. In effect, robust lineage guards against silent regressions and supports accountability through time.
Open representations and peer scrutiny fortify long-term reliability.
A principled approach to variable derivation emphasizes modularity and explicit interfaces. Each module should declare its inputs, outputs, and tolerance for uncertainty, so that integrate-and-test cycles reveal incompatibilities early. Prefer stateless components where feasible, or clearly delineate stateful behavior with reproducible initialization. When modules rely on external services, record endpoint versions, service SLAs, and fallback strategies. This disciplined separation ensures that substitutions or upgrades do not silently invalidate results. It also allows independent teams to audit specific modules without wading through unrelated code, speeding up verification processes and reducing cognitive load.
Transparency is bolstered by open representations of data transformations. Provide machine-readable formats describing derivation logic, such as standardized schemas or declarative configurations. These representations should be auditable by automated tools capable of checking consistency between specified logic and actual execution. Encourage peer review of derivation definitions and implementations, inviting independent statisticians or methodologists to challenge assumptions. Public or controlled-access repositories with version histories support collaborative scrutiny while preserving data privacy. When combined with thorough testing, open representations help ensure long-term reliability and collective confidence in the system.
ADVERTISEMENT
ADVERTISEMENT
A durable capability for auditability safeguards trust and impact.
It is crucial to quantify and communicate uncertainty at every derivation stage. Provide explicit error bars, confidence intervals, or posterior distributions for derived variables, along with clear explanations of how uncertainty propagates downstream. Use sensitivity analyses to show how results respond to plausible perturbations in inputs or modeling choices. Document the limits of applicability, including scenarios where the method may underperform or produce misleading outputs. This transparency clarifies expectations and informs decision-makers about risks associated with relying on particular variables. By openly discussing uncertainty, teams foster more prudent usage of results and better risk management.
Finally, cultivate a culture of reproducible research and development. Encourage researchers to share complete pipelines, data dictionaries, and configuration files alongside publications or reports. Provide incentives for thorough documentation and reproducibility, not just performance metrics. Invest in automated testing, continuous integration, and regular audits to catch regressions early. Promote training that emphasizes methodological rigor, provenance, and ethical considerations. When practitioners internalize these principles, the organization gains a durable capability: derivations that can be audited, reproduced, and trusted across time and teams.
In building resilient derivation systems, prioritize traceable decisions as first-class artifacts. Each computation should leave a traceable footprint, including inputs, transformations, and the rationale behind choices. Establish automated checks that compare current results with previous baselines, flagging unexpected deviations for review. Reinforce data governance by documenting ownership, accountability, and alignment with regulatory requirements. Clear escalation paths for anomalies ensure timely responses and mitigation. By embedding traceability into the development lifecycle, organizations create a living record of how conclusions were reached and why those conclusions remain credible as conditions change.
Ultimately, transparent variable derivation is not a one-time achievement but an ongoing practice. It requires disciplined documentation, verifiable execution, and collaborative scrutiny. When teams commit to transparent provenance, they lay a foundation for innovation that respects reproducibility, ethics, and accountability. The payoff is a durable trust that can withstand scrutiny from internal stakeholders and external auditors alike. As methods evolve, the same principles apply: define, document, test, and verify, with openness as the guiding standard. This evergreen framework can adapt to emerging data landscapes while preserving the integrity of every derived variable.
Related Articles
Statistics
Reproducible workflows blend data cleaning, model construction, and archival practice into a coherent pipeline, ensuring traceable steps, consistent environments, and accessible results that endure beyond a single project or publication.
July 23, 2025
Statistics
This evergreen overview surveys robust strategies for detecting, quantifying, and adjusting differential measurement bias across subgroups in epidemiology, ensuring comparisons remain valid despite instrument or respondent variations.
July 15, 2025
Statistics
A practical guide outlining transparent data cleaning practices, documentation standards, and reproducible workflows that enable peers to reproduce results, verify decisions, and build robust scientific conclusions across diverse research domains.
July 18, 2025
Statistics
This evergreen guide explains why leaving one study out at a time matters for robustness, how to implement it correctly, and how to interpret results to safeguard conclusions against undue influence.
July 18, 2025
Statistics
Across diverse research settings, researchers confront collider bias when conditioning on shared outcomes, demanding robust detection methods, thoughtful design, and corrective strategies that preserve causal validity and inferential reliability.
July 23, 2025
Statistics
This evergreen exploration surveys how scientists measure biomarker usefulness, detailing thresholds, decision contexts, and robust evaluation strategies that stay relevant across patient populations and evolving technologies.
August 04, 2025
Statistics
This evergreen guide explains how researchers can strategically plan missing data designs to mitigate bias, preserve statistical power, and enhance inference quality across diverse experimental settings and data environments.
July 21, 2025
Statistics
This evergreen article explores robust variance estimation under intricate survey designs, emphasizing weights, stratification, clustering, and calibration to ensure precise inferences across diverse populations.
July 25, 2025
Statistics
Understanding how cross-validation estimates performance can vary with resampling choices is crucial for reliable model assessment; this guide clarifies how to interpret such variability and integrate it into robust conclusions.
July 26, 2025
Statistics
A comprehensive exploration of how domain-specific constraints and monotone relationships shape estimation, improving robustness, interpretability, and decision-making across data-rich disciplines and real-world applications.
July 23, 2025
Statistics
A rigorous exploration of methods to measure how uncertainties travel through layered computations, with emphasis on visualization techniques that reveal sensitivity, correlations, and risk across interconnected analytic stages.
July 18, 2025
Statistics
Expert elicitation and data-driven modeling converge to strengthen inference when data are scarce, blending human judgment, structured uncertainty, and algorithmic learning to improve robustness, credibility, and decision quality.
July 24, 2025